Cooperative H-infinity Estimation for Large-Scale Interconnected Linear Systems
Published 2 Jul 2015 in cs.SY | (1507.00403v1)
Abstract: In this paper, a synthesis method for distributed estimation is presented, which is suitable for dealing with large-scale interconnected linear systems with disturbance. The main feature of the proposed method is that local estimators only estimate a reduced set of state variables and their complexity does not increase with the size of the system. Nevertheless, the local estimators are able to deal with lack of local detectability. Moreover, the estimators guarantee H-infinity-performance of the estimates with respect to model and measurement disturbances.
